About Douglas
Hi! This is Douglas, (a name weve made for him). He was found about 2 weeks ago walking in the blazing sun on the side of the road, no tag, unregistered microchip, and as thirsty as ever. After multiple attempts to surrender him or find its original owner im coming to you! He seems to be 2-3 years old, is neutered, short haired, pre-trained, with a sweet affectionate personality. If you are interested or know of anyone else who, maybe, just maybe interested please reach out ASAP !! Key notes: -Like i said he is very affectionate and loves to jump and is relentless to kiss you face and knock u down! -It seems to me he has not been up-kept in a long while. Hes a little stinky, overgrown nails, scared of older men and is reactive to agressive mannerisms (yelling, grabbing harshly, etc.) However he does know commands like "paw" and will shake your hand everytime! -this buddy needs some love...
